  • In order to explain the U-shaped pattern of autocorrelations of stock returns i.e., autocorrelations starting around 0 for short-term horizons and becoming negative and then moving toward 0 for long-term horizons, researchers suggested the use of a state-space model consisting of an I(1) permanent component and an AR(1) stationary component, where the two components are assumed to be independent. They concluded that auto-regression coefficients derived from the state-space model follow a U-shape pattern and thus there is mean-reversion in stock prices. In this paper, we show that only negative autocorrelations are feasible under the assumption that the permanent component and the stationary component are independent in the state-space model. When the two components are allowed to be correlated in the state-space model, we show that the sign of the auto-regression coefficients is not restricted as negative. Monthly return data for all NYSE stocks for the period from 1926 to 2007 support the state-space model with correlated noise processes. However, the auto-regression coefficients of the ARIMA process, equivalent to the state-space model with correlated noise processes, do not follow a U-shaped pattern, but are always positive.

  • In logistic environments, a process, in that it manages the flow of materials among partners, involves more than one organization. In this regard, a logistic process, as a combined process consisting of multiple sub processes, needs to be managed with controling interaction among partners. In achieving systematic management of a logistic process, traditional Business Process Management (BPM) cannot be used for the entire flow, since it lacks the ability to manage interactions among partners. Particularly in logistic environments where RFID technologies are used, how to deal with the connection between RFID event and logistic flow has not been properly addressed. To overcome this limitation, this paper proposes a new method of managing multi-organizational logistic processes based on RFID events. We define inter-workflow pattern, and suggest ECA(Event-Condition-Action) rules for auto triggering of logistic processes. To adjust the rules to RFID events, we invent RFID-based ECA rules using complex event. A prototype system has been developed for the purpose of demonstrating the effectiveness of our approach.

  • In the mold parts industry, customers typically place orders for order-made parts with some changes to the design specifications of ready-made parts within the extent of the manufacturing capability of the supplier. Being customized for ready-made parts, existing e-Catalog systems cannot support the above trade pattern. To solve this problem, an ETO (engineering-to-order) method is proposed here, enabling the trade of order-made parts in an e-Catalog system by utilizing the design and manufacturing knowledge of the part suppliers. After addressing technological challenges and solutions, we briefly describe application of the ETO method to two types of mold parts - ejector pins and mold bases.

  • Objectives : This study was performed to develop a standard instrument of Pattern Identification for jing ji and zheng chong. Methods : The advisor committee on this study was organized by 15 neuropsychiatry professors of oriental medical colleges. The items and structure of the instrument were based on review of published literature. We took consultation 2 times from the advisor committee and we also took additional advices by e-mail. Results : 1. We divided the symptoms and signs of jing ji and zheng chong into 9 pattern identification. - heart deficiency with timidity(心膽虛怯), heart qi deficiency(心氣虛), heart blood deficiency(心血虛), heart yang inactivity(心陽不振), heart blood stasis(心血瘀阻), phlegm turbidity obstructing(痰濁阻滯), yin deficiency with effulgent fire(陰虛火旺), water qi intimidating the heart(水氣凌心), dual deficiency of the heart and spleen(心脾兩虛). 2. We got the mean weights that reflect standard deviation to each symptom of 9 pattern identification which had been scored on a 100-point scale. 3. We made out the Korean instrument of the pattern identification for jing ji and zheng chong. It was composed of 17 questions in question-and-answer form. Conclusions : Instrument of Pattern Identification for jing ji and zheng chong was developed through experts' disscussion. If the validity and reliability of this instrument is confirmed through additional clinical trial, the instrument of pattern identification for jing ji and zheng chong is expected to be applied to the subsequent research.

  • The advance of information technology has changed the business environment, and the business process between the trading partners has been evolved with these changes. However, the business process between trading partners requires human interface for interchanging information or making a decision even though they collaborate each other or are coupled tightly, and this interrupts seamless business processes between them. To overcome this limitations, a new concept of self-integration has been emerged. The self-integration means a true integration among enterprise applications without human interface, and it might be the future direction of integrations. In this study, we introduced the concept of self-integration environment and business process model for supply chain planning. And, we analyzed the negotiation processes and classified the negotiation patterns for integrated supply chain planning in self-integration environment, and then we proposed a generic business process model for negotiation of extended and integrated supply chain planning by integrating the suggested negotiation pattern with business scenarios.

  • Previous e-financial anomalies analysis and detection technology collects large amounts of electronic financial transaction logs generated from electronic financial business systems into big-data-based storage space. And it detects abnormal transactions in real time using detection rules that analyze transaction pattern profiling of existing customers and various accident transactions. However, deep analysis such as attempts to access e-finance by insiders of financial institutions with large scale of damages and social ripple effects and stealing important information from e-financial users through bypass of internal control environments is not conducted. This paper analyzes the management status of e-financial security programs of financial companies and draws the possibility that they are allies in security control of insiders who exploit vulnerability in management. In order to efficiently respond to this problem, it will present a comprehensive e-financial security management environment linked to insider threat monitoring as well as the existing e-financial transaction detection system.

  • EDI (Electronic Data Interchange) has been widely utilized to support Business Activities since it has such advantages as fast transfer of information, less documentation work, efficient information exchange etc. Recently e-business environment has urged the traditional EDI system to be changed to ebXML framework. To apply the ebXML framework to a certain industry, it is required to implement Business Process (BP), Core Component (CC), Collaboration Protocol Profile (CPP), Collaboration Protocol Agreement (CPA), Messaging system etc. We have selected the port and logistics industry as a target domain to apply ebXML framework, since the EDI usage ratio of it is relatively higher than other industries. In this paper, we have analyzed the current status of EDI system and transaction processes in the port and logistics industry. We have defined the business process that will be registered in the registry/repository, the main component of ebXML framework, using UN/CEFACT modeling methodology. And Business Collaborations, Business Transactions, Business Document Flows, Choreography, Pattern, etc. are represented using UML according to UN/ CEFACT modeling methodology, to apply ebXML Framework to the port and logistics distribution industry. Also we have suggested the meta methodology for applying the ebXML framework to other industries.
